Effect of Spraying Regimes on Properties of Amorphous Carbon Coatings

The paper investigates the effect of condensation energy of emissioned flux of monatomic carbon, created by magnetronic dispersion, on properties of amorphous carbon coatings. While increasing discharge current from 0,5 up to 2,5 A coating density is increased from 2,3 up to 3,2 g/cm3. Finishing treatment of coatings in glow discharge (U = 1250 V; / = 0,15 A; t = 15 min) ensures hardness increase by 40 %. Electrical resistance of a coating is going up while increasing distance between the sprayed cathode and substrate.
